This Fresh Food Company with production facilities in multiple countries is looking for a Production Planner to be based at their Northampton offices in the UK.

Offering a starting salary of between £28-30k .This role is a full time Office based role spread over 4 days, working (Sunday to Wednesday)

The Supply Chain /Production Planner will ideally have a background of planning multiple ingredients to make a product. A previous planning background from Food/Desserts/Ready meals./Sandwiches/ Salads / Fruit etc. would be ideal.

Role Description

This role would fulfil an integral role within the Production planning team and will provide the successful candidate with an opportunity to get involved in several projects and activities.

  • To communicate fully and efficiently with all customers and colleagues, both within the UK and internationally, on supply chain issues
  • Collate orders and allocate to sites using site planners and customer specific stock sheets.
  • Advising productions sites of final figures.
  • To advise on airspace required to transport goods.
  • Working collaboratively with production teams (UK and abroad)
  • Advise production sites on any amendments required to airfreight for immediate use and in the short term.
  • Address and problem solve issues affecting production and customer orders.
  • To escalate unresolved issues to Line manager a
  • To forecast customer needs for the short term, using both customer data and own judgement

We are looking for someone who is self-motivated and an excellent communicator, able to interact with global teams and stakeholders at varying levels within the business. Experience in a Production Planning /Supply chain role is highly desirable.
